Custom Furniture Made In London: Crafted To Fit Properly
London homes aren’t known for being generous with room. You learn quickly that every inch matters, and that’s why made-to-measure furniture is worth thinking about.
Maybe you’ve got a narrow terrace in Peckham, chances are the layout’s a bit weird. Most off-the-shelf stuff ends up wasting space. But when you get something built to fit, you stop fighting your home.
I’ve seen it all, from lofts to basements. One job in Stoke Newington had this wonky bedroom with a chimney breast. We got clever with the layout, and the result looked like it had always been there.
That’s the beauty of going custom—you’re not limited. It works around your life, not the other way round. Need a bench with drawers underneath? Done. Fancy a desk that folds away into the wall? Easy. Want a wardrobe that wraps around a corner and hides the boiler? Sorted.
